[#67] Molecularity of an elementary reaction, P + Q → R + S is
Correct Answer
(B) 2
Explanation
Solution: The molecularity of an elementary reaction represents the number of molecules or particles that come together to react and form the products. In the given elementary reaction: P + Q → R + S There are two reactant molecules (P and Q) that come together to form two product molecules (R and S). Therefore, the molecularity of this elementary reaction is 2 . So, the correct answer is Option B: 2 .
